## Runbook: Ormshim refactor rollout

We're replacing the legacy Quillbase ORM layer with Ormshim behind a flag. If query latency spikes after a deploy, flip the flag off first, investigate second. Known hotspots: lazy-loaded joins in the billing module and the N+1 pattern in report generation. Logs tagged ormshim.compat show fallback hits. Don't touch the connection pool sizing without paging the data team. The flag and pool settings currently in effect are these.

deployment values, fahap-hahaf:
[casdor]
port = 9200
region = south-2
host = casdor.qirvanworks.corp
timeout_ms = 3000
retries = 4

## Gatewing rollout — rate limits

Quick heads-up before you ship: the new per-tenant rate limiting in Gatewing 4.2 defaults to 600 req/min, which is tighter than staging. Bump the Fenwick Labs tenants to 1200 before cutover or the batch jobs will trip. Watch the throttle dashboard for the first twenty minutes and roll back if 429s spike past 2%.

Once metrics look clean, sign the release manifest so the edge nodes will accept it. Use the key below.

rollout seal: bky9_PeXH1fTLY

Ticket: SQL lint rules drifted between repos

Welcome aboard. The Querncliff data repos are supposed to share one SQL lint profile, but the warehouse repo pinned an older ruleset in March and the two have drifted — keyword casing and join-style checks now disagree, so cross-repo PRs fail inconsistently. Your task: reconcile both repos against the canonical profile and remove local overrides. The canonical linter configuration you should apply everywhere is as follows.

deployment values, faduf-tawep:
SORDOR_LOG_LEVEL=error
SORDOR_METRICS_HOST=metrics.sordor.nelvrolabs.internal
SORDOR_POOL_SIZE=4